2657772 - Creating a table in tempdb causing 1538 and 2761 messages - SAP ASE

Symptom

Error 1538 outputs wrong value (typically an hugely excessively large value) for needed "max utility parallel degree".

Example:
Msg 1538, Level 17, State 1:
Server 'ASE', Line 2:
max utility parallel degree 1 is less than the required 'max utility parallel'
degree' 4294967307 to create clustered index on partition table. Change the
parallel degree to required parallel degree and retry.

Msg 2761, Level 16, State 4:
Server 'ASE', Line 2:
Failed to create declarative constraints on table 't1' in database 'tempdb'.
